Ref: 20252597 As a Communications Specialist at the Cultural Administration, you will become part of our dedicated team that collaboratively plans, creates, and implements communication initiatives – both externally and internally. The role combines strategic thinking with practical execution, and is ideal for someone who wants to work with both the big picture and details. We work editorially and proactively with stories in text, images, and video content. Through digital platforms and social media, we highlight Malmö's cultural activities and make them accessible to the city's residents. You will provide communication support closely tied to the administration's various departments, with a special focus on Malmö Art Museum. The work may also involve participating in larger communication projects within the administration and at a city-wide level. Evening work may be required in this position. You will report to the Communications Director. Duties - Develop and follow up communication plans for various projects and activities. - Conduct target group analysis and adapt communication to different target groups' needs. - Plan, produce, and publish content in text, images, and film for digital and social channels. - Contribute to editorial planning and strategic communication work together with colleagues. - Provide strategic and operational communication support to administration activities. - Work on project communication related to Malmö Art Museum. - Participate in and contribute to city-wide communication initiatives. Qualifications We are looking for someone who: - Has a university degree in Media and Communication Studies (180 ECTS) or other education deemed equivalent and relevant by the employer. - Has at least three years of experience in both strategic and operational communication work. - Has experience developing communication plans, target group analyses, and messaging platforms. - Has experience producing targeted content for different channels. - Has excellent ability to express oneself in Swedish, both verbally and in writing, and preferably in English. Additional languages are meritorious. - Can initiate, structure, and plan work, with good knowledge of Office Suite, InDesign, and experience with generative AI. - Is independent and collaborative, enjoying working closely with colleagues, managers, and various activities. - Is structured, curious, solution-oriented, and able to manage multiple projects simultaneously. - Has extensive experience with social media and digital communication. - Experience working for a politically governed organization is meritorious.
